A must for anyone who loves classic cars, the Barcelona-Sitges International Vintage Car Rallye is back. Some 60 cars that date from 1927 and earlier participate in this 'race' (it's more about impressive looks than speed) that starts out from Plaça de Sant Jaume in Barcelona and heads down to Sitges. The oldest moving show of its kind, it's been held every year since 1959, and now's your chance to get a close look at the cars when they're on display on Saturday March 3 at the L'Illa Diagonal shopping centre from 10am to 9.30pm. Car owners/drivers get into the spirit by dressing up in period garb, and they the cars head out on Sunday the 4th at 8.30am to Plaça de Sant Jaume, where they'll dip into a chocolate feast at the City Hall. At 11am the caravan of vintage vehicles sets off with the oldest cars out front. They'll parade along several streets in Barcelona including Ferran, La Rambla, Av. Paral·lel and Gran Vía, and pass through towns like Baix Llobregat and Garraf before arriving in Sitges.
